#c56205 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#c56205 is composed of 77.3% red, 38.4% green and 2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 50.3% magenta, 97.5% yellow and 22.7% black. It has a hue angle of 29.1 degrees, a saturation of 95% and a lightness of 39.6%. #c56205 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ffc40a with #8b0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6600.

● #c56205 color description : Strong orange.
#c56205 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#c56205 has RGB values of R:197, G:98, B:5 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.5, Y:0.97, K:0.23. Its decimal value is 12935685.
